What Are The Health Benefits Of Different Cooking Methods For Meats?
Introduction
Cooking methods play a crucial role in determining the health benefits of different meats. The way we prepare our meat not only affects its flavor and texture but also influences nutrient retention and fat levels, making it important to choose the right methods. By understanding various cooking techniques, you can make healthier choices and enhance the nutritional value of your meals.
Health Benefits of Popular Cooking Methods for Meat
Each method of cooking meat offers distinct advantages and disadvantages in terms of health and nutrition. Here is an overview of common cooking techniques and their effects on meat's health benefits.
- Grilling: This method allows fat to drip off the meat, resulting in reduced fat content and lower calorie intake. Furthermore, grilling enhances flavor through a chemical reaction known as the Maillard reaction, which delivers a savory, charred taste that many enjoy.
- Baking: Baking meats, such as chicken and fish, helps retain moisture while avoiding additional fat. This cooking method serves as a healthier alternative to frying, as it typically requires little to no oil.
- Steaming: Steaming is considered one of the healthiest cooking techniques as it preserves more nutrients than boiling or frying. It is particularly suitable for lean meats, ensuring they stay moist without unnecessary fat.
- Stir-frying: When performed correctly, stir-frying promotes nutrient absorption using minimal oil. This technique also encourages the combination of vegetables with your meat, enhancing overall nutritional value.
Cooking Methods to Avoid for Better Health
While some cooking techniques are beneficial, others can pose health risks, especially when preparing meats. It is essential to exercise caution with the following methods.
- Frying: Deep-frying significantly increases the amount of unhealthy fats and calories in meat. Regular consumption of fried foods can lead to weight gain and elevated cholesterol levels.
- Charbroiling: Cooking meats over extremely high temperatures can generate harmful compounds known as heterocyclic amines (HCAs) and pol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s), both linked to cancer. To minimize these risks, it is advisable to control cooking temperatures and avoid direct flame exposure.
